Scope of Works
• Assess kitchen layout and wall structure for shelf placement
• Take accurate measurements and mark installation points
• Secure brackets or supports into studs or masonry using appropriate fixings
• Install custom shelving units, ensuring level alignment and stability
• Clean the work area and inspect for safe, load-bearing installation
Typical Cost Breakdown
Charge Type | Low £ | High £ | Notes |
Call-out / Minimum | £60 | £90 | Site visit and measurement |
Labour per hour | £50 | £70 | Skilled carpenter or handyman |
Materials (brackets, fixings) | £20 | £40 | Screws, plugs, brackets; shelving often supplied by customer |
TOTAL (most jobs) | £130 | £250 | Final cost depends on wall type & shelf length |
Time on Site
Most custom shelving installations take 1.5 to 3 hours, depending on the number of shelves, wall material (e.g., plasterboard, tile, brick), and access.
Questions to Ask Your Tradie
• What experience do you have installing custom shelving in kitchens?
• Can you install into tiled or brick walls without damage?
• Will you supply fixings and tools, or should I provide any materials?
How to Avoid Surprises
• Confirm that walls are free of pipes or hidden electrical wires before drilling
• Ensure all shelves and design specifications are ready on site
• Discuss weight capacity requirements to ensure proper reinforcement
